2015 Cen$ible Energy Update
Our first year of the Cen$ible Energy program was a success! Below shows the economic impact of the program.
Total # of rebates
: 284
Total $ spent locally
: $70,159.24
Total $ spent outside Yampa Valley
: $35,868.13
Total amount distributed in rebates
: $22,112.62
